Last week Ducati finally made clear that Enea Bastianini will ride next to Francesco Bagnaia in the factory team. Now, Bestia’s crew chief reveals why Ducati probably chose his protégé.
After months of waiting for a decision on the Ducati line-up for 2023, Enea Bastianini will be promoted from the Gresini Ducati into the red leather suits.

One of the reasons, Bestia is able to show his potential in his second year in MotoGP is his crew chief Alberto Giribuola.
Having been Andrea Dovizioso’s crew chief in his time at the factory Ducati, Giribuola is now an essential part of Bastianini’s team.
From the get-go, he saw something special in Bastianini’s riding:
“His confidence with the front, the feeling he has with the front tire in the last part of entering the corner, he can really gain a lot in comparison to the other riders.”
“I think Enea can stay at the limit of the grip without spinning the rear. He takes out the maximum in acceleration, but at the end of the race he still has 10 to 15% more compared to the others.”

But to Giribuola the most impressive thing about Bestia is his ability to develop and improve his style in order to perform well woith the given circumstances.
“Last year, sometimes there was a limit for him because he was not able to push at the maximum, like in qualifying. This year he’s able to switch when it’s time for qualifying.”
